Hydrophilic PES Membranes: Enhanced Filtration Performance
Polyethersulfone membranes provide a substantial enhancement in filtration quality when engineered to be water-attracting. Traditional polyethersulfone materials are generally water-averse, leading to clogging and lower permeability. Surface treatment with hydrophilic chemicals improves adhesion and reduces contaminant buildup , leading in enhanced filtration potential for applications like liquid purification and biopharmaceutical processes .

Understanding Hydrophilic PES Membrane Technology
PES membranes technologies offers a significant improvement in filtration applications, especially within liquid systems. The intrinsic hydrophobicity of standard polyethersulfone can limit performance when filtering hydrophilic media. However, hydrophilic treatments via surface compound attachment form a membrane with superior wetting properties , leading to minimized clogging and increased flow rate . This permits for more productive running and broadened membranes longevity in various fields.

Choosing the Right Hydrophilic PES Membrane for Your Application
Opting for the appropriate hydrophilic Polyethersulfone sheet requires detailed evaluation of your particular process. PES membranes offer superior chemical resistance and strong permeability, but the extent of hydrophilicity considerably affects functionality, especially if handling aqueous mixtures . Hence , closely review the wetting characteristics and micron size depending on the type of your feedstock and the desired separation outcome .
Benefits of Hydrophilic PES Membrane Filtration
Hydrophilic polymeric membrane processes offers key advantages for various uses . Unlike standard hydrophobic PES , the hydrophilic area treatment enhances aqueous compatibility , resulting in reduced fouling . This results to improved flow , increasing membranes lifetime span. Additionally , hydrophilic PES exhibit superior chemical stability and structural strength , allowing them suitable for demanding purification procedures .
